
On 22.05.2015 10:59, Andrea Bolognani wrote:
This will allow us to use vshError() to report errors from inside vshCommandOpt*(), instead of replicating the same logic and error messages all over the place.
We also have more context inside the vshCommandOpt*() functions, for example the actual value used on the command line, which means we can produce more detailed error messages. --- tools/virsh-domain-monitor.c | 90 +++---- tools/virsh-domain.c | 598 +++++++++++++++++++++---------------------- tools/virsh-host.c | 46 ++-- tools/virsh-interface.c | 14 +- tools/virsh-network.c | 34 +-- tools/virsh-nodedev.c | 6 +- tools/virsh-pool.c | 26 +- tools/virsh-secret.c | 8 +- tools/virsh-snapshot.c | 88 +++---- tools/virsh-volume.c | 34 +-- tools/virsh.c | 107 ++++---- tools/virsh.h | 77 +++--- 12 files changed, 574 insertions(+), 554 deletions(-)

I don't think this is needed. vshCommandOptBool should never return an error. Well, it's returning just if a flag was specified or not.

This is of course different, specified value may not be a number in which case we want an error to be reported.
vshError(ctl, _("Numeric value for <%s> option is malformed or out of range"), "period");
